POP QUIZ Answer. If you didnt read the full thread and posts of January 22 POP QUIZ, you should. The question was about care/cleaning of our parrots, in numbers. How many cages + how many birds + how many bowls = how much time. I asked this question because for new flock members or the parrot curious there is a tendency to think you can schedule this type of work, like washing a dog. As veteran flock members we know that its a daily event, it just IS part of the lifestyle. Parrot care/cleaning/cage maintenance isnt a scheduled event. It is part of the total of being a human in a flock. Whether your flock is one or many, the care part resembles having a 3 year old in the house rather than a dog. They are very much children and they are very much busy making messes when they are awake. Youll find routines build themselves up as far as general cleanliness, and certain processes (like food bowls), but youll always be picking up, putting away, wiping down, wiping up, wiping off, sweeping, mopping, vacuuming and dusting. Its part of the lifestyle choice itself. And youll find like most new habits, if you stick with it and make it a habit, you wont notice that work that much. Generally. So for the parrot curious, and the new flock members here, realize a lifestyle choice is just that, a lifestyle. There are many ways to create a home and flock environment to make this part of the lifestyle somewhat easy and certainly doable. But dont bother adding up the hours spent. Its much nicer to add up the parrot kisses gained. :)
